ABSTRACT A double-lever hammer operating according to the inertia principle--at the end of a first lever operated as an armature lies the fulcrum of a second lever, and when the first lever hits a stop, the inertial forces encountered cause the upper lever arm of the second lever, carrying the print head, to be moved increased velocity in the direction of the record carrier; and a double-lever hammer operating operated as an armature lies the fulcrum of a second lever, and when the first lever hits a stop, the second lever is of the lever ratio, the upper lever arm of the second lever, carrying the print head, moves at increased velocity in the direction of the record carrier.
